
Study in Syracuse and Berlin
The Atlantis dual degree is a joint programme offered by the Maxwell School of Citizenship and Public Affairs in Syracuse, New York, and the Hertie School.
Atlantis students complete the first year of their studies in Syracuse either in the Master in International Relations (MAIR) or Master of Public Administration (MPA) programme, and finish the dual degree at the Hertie School either in the Master of Public Policy (MPP) or Master of International Affairs (MIA) programme.
Dual degree students may not take a gap year and thus are unable to participate in the Hertie School's Professional Year programme.

How to apply
Interested candidates should apply through the Hertie School's application portal either through the MPP or MIA application forms mentioning their Atlantis candidacy in the "Further information" section.
Students are encouraged to apply by 1 February. Admitted candidates with financial need are eligible for 25% tuition waivers for their year at the Hertie School.
The final deadline for the Atlantis dual degree with the Maxwell School of Citizenship and Public Affairs is 1 May of each year.
